Celebrating Aguilar Alcuaz at the Gateway Suites

The month of August will be a celebration of art at the Araneta Center.
From August 8 to 14, sixty rare works from Federico Aguilar Alcuaz will be featured in a special exhibit entitled “Celebrating Aguilar Alcuaz”. The curators of the show have put together these interesting works to pay tribute to the late National Artist.
Born in June 6, 1932 in Manila, Federico Aguilar Alcuaz was an award winning Filipino painter. He was a product of the University of the Philippines School of Fine Arts. He moved to Barcelona in 1956 after receiving a grant from the Spanish government to pursue further studies in art. He later on became part of the group La Punyalada who later on became the exponents of “neo-figurativism” and among the forerunners of modern and contemporary art in Spain.
The collection will definitely affirm the artist who has won national and international recognition. The maestro’s works to be displayed will reveal that he is an abstract artist of the highest order. Some of the most elegant nudes in painting is said to have been given life via Alcuaz’s brush. Although he is known to been faithful to basic classical disciplines, he was also famous for shunning theatrical gesture and dramatic color, instead, putting them in a more contemporary context.
